Analytical Investigation of Noyes-Field Model for Time-Fractional Belousov-Zhabotinsky Reaction

Mohammed Kbiri Alaoui et al.

Summary: In this article, the solution of the time-fractional Belousov-Zhabotinskii reaction is found using modified Adomian decomposition method and homotopy perturbation method with Yang transform. The obtained solution is in series form, which helps in investigating the analytical solution of the system. The proposed methods are verified for accuracy through an illustrative example and comparison with graphs, showing the desired rate of convergence to the exact solution. The technique's primary benefit lies in its low computational requirements and applicability to various domains.

A spectral collocation method for solving fractional KdV and KdV-Burgers equations with non-singular kernel derivatives

M. M. Khader et al.

Summary: This paper investigates the spectral collocation method with the use of Chebyshev polynomials in analyzing space fractional Korteweg-de Vries and space fractional Korteweg-de Vries-Burgers equations based on the Caputo-Fabrizio fractional derivative. The proposed method simplifies the models to ordinary differential equations and solves them effectively, which is the first work studying Caputo-Fabrizio space fractional derivative for the proposed equations. The results are accurate and the method can be applied to various fractional systems.

Pattern formation induced by fractional cross-diffusion in a 3-species food chain model with harvesting

Naveed Iqbal et al.

Summary: This article explores pattern formation caused by fractional cross-diffusion in a 3-species ecological symbiosis model. Stability of equilibrium points and conditions for Turing instability are analyzed, with identification of patterns such as hexagons, rhombus, spots, squares, strips and waves through dynamical analysis. Theoretical results are verified using numerical simulations.

A Novel Homotopy Perturbation Method with Applications to Nonlinear Fractional Order KdV and Burger Equation with Exponential-Decay Kernel

Shabir Ahmad et al.

Summary: In this paper, the Yang transform homotopy perturbation method (YTHPM) is introduced as a novel approach. The formula for the Yang transform of Caputo-Fabrizio fractional order derivatives is provided, along with an algorithm for solving the corresponding partial differential equation in series form. The convergence of the method to the exact solution is demonstrated through examples with detailed solutions, and comparisons between exact and approximate solutions are made using tables and graphs.
